Our approach focuses on generating awareness, understanding, and acceptance for large-scale transformations, but can be tapered for smaller engagements to integrate and ...A community of practice (CoP) is a group of people who "share a concern or a passion for something they do and learn how to do it better as they interact regularly". The concept was first proposed by cognitive anthropologist Jean Lave and educational theorist Etienne Wenger in their 1991 book Situated Learning (Lave & Wenger 1991).Wenger then significantly expanded on the concept in his 1998 ...

At the end, we’ll look at a basic small business accounting department structure as well as how accounting software can help with each task. 1.Typically, org models fall on the spectrum between "mechanistic" and “organic." Mechanistic reporting structures are more hierarchical with a top-down approach to reporting, managing and delegating. Organic structures are more collaborative and flexible.
